A heavy, geometric sans with broad proportions and rounded bowls that read as clean and sturdy. Strokes are monolinear with minimal modulation, and terminals are mostly straight-cut, giving the shapes a crisp, contemporary edge. Counters are relatively open for the weight, with circular/elliptical construction evident in letters like O, C, and G, while diagonals (V, W, X, Y) are strong and stable. Lowercase forms lean toward simple, single-storey construction with compact joins and a large, solid presence, producing an even, high-impact texture in text.

This face is strongest in display roles such as headlines, posters, brand marks, and packaging where a solid, modern voice is needed. The broad, rounded geometry and sturdy strokes also suit wayfinding and signage-style applications, especially at medium to large sizes where its clean counters and simple forms stay legible.

The overall tone is assertive and contemporary, combining a pragmatic, no-nonsense structure with a friendly softness from its rounded curves. It feels designed to be noticed—confident and straightforward rather than delicate or quirky—making it well suited to bold messaging.

The design intention appears to be a contemporary, high-impact sans that balances geometric clarity with approachable rounded forms. It prioritizes strong presence, quick recognition, and consistent texture for prominent typographic communication.

Spacing appears generous enough to keep heavy letterforms from clogging, helping short words and headlines remain clear. Numerals match the letterforms in weight and roundness, supporting consistent typographic color across mixed alphanumeric settings.
